Many types of cells are involved, the airway epithelium is shed; eosinophils, T lymphocytes, polymorphonuclear cells, mast cells, and macrophages are present in an activated state and release proinflammatory mediators, cytokines and growth factors.

In particular, it was repeatedly demonstrated that continuous use of inhaled β.-agonists is associated with an impairment of their acute protective effects against bronchoconstrictive stimuli .
